"In The Beginning..."

I was raised in The Ben Lucas House..on the Northeast corner of the Burkhardt Farm.  I have many memories of that house, and NO bathroom...a two seater out-house - which was later my Playhouse or Club house.. Then it was a chicken coup...
I lived there until 5-6 years old, early 1960's when my parents built the brick house in front of the Ben Lucas house (with the steepest staircase I'd ever seen!).

House on 5 points Rd, Perrysburg, Ohio

This is an aerial view of the house that was built at 9901 Five Points Road (Perrysburg Township, Perrysburg, Ohio) where the Ben Lucas House once stood (about where the swimming pool is sitting).
